Stepping into this aikido session feels welcoming for anyone aged 12 and over looking to build skills in a focused, non-competitive environment. Participants arrive ready to move, with the group gathering for structured practice that emphasises blending with an opponent's energy rather than direct confrontation.
The session follows traditional Aikikai methods, where beginners and more experienced practitioners train side by side. You will work through footwork drills, basic throws, and joint locks while learning to stay relaxed and aware. Partners rotate regularly so everyone gets varied practice, and the instructor offers clear guidance suited to each person's level.
This adults and youth aikido activity runs weekly on Wednesday and Friday evenings, giving consistent opportunities to develop technique and fitness without pressure. Open to visitors as well as regular attendees, it suits those wanting reliable training in Howick.
